This really confusing. I just built my PC from scratch and the fans wont slow down. The BIOS says the the system is a nice cool 37C, but when I look at the Speedfan results it says everything is hot... GPU: 50C, System: 121C.... Like my PC should be on fire at 121C. And it says this right as I starts it up. I ran the BIOS for an hour and it stayed at 37C.... What is going on? And how do I make my fans slow down?
 
121ºC probably means there is no sensor present.

The nzxt can control up to 5 fan on AUTO or MANUAL mode.
The Zalman can control 4 fans (3 3pin and 1 4pin pwm) but no auto mode.

Zalman also come whit a useful POWER meter that show you the WATT usage off your FULL system ( i had read that its inacurate but, helpfull info to know BTW)

I like better the NZXT but it take 2 slot vs Zalman only one slot. the 2 come with Temp probe, all working well. The NZXT use its probe to vary Fan speed on auto mode but i prefer Manual.
